Transaction 105ae638e4a424f0e32863d7e5659f7ce57cc4fae7e30a4bc5e3ea0d995293b1
1 Input
2 Outputs
- 105ae638e4a424f0e32863d7e5659f7ce57cc4fae7e30a4bc5e3ea0d995293b1:0
- 105ae638e4a424f0e32863d7e5659f7ce57cc4fae7e30a4bc5e3ea0d995293b1:1
value 11000000
address 1DK7icrsqLMCRcgm6QjQHd5cA94vq6Ccax
value 122990000
address 17CLXACoaAVBT2P7juKgSgjoUYrcATjhwL